`
hll127
  • 浏览: 286 次
最近访客 更多访客>>
文章分类
社区版块
存档分类
最新评论

轻量级Java类cms系统 --- tjpcms

阅读更多

tjpcms是一套基于java的轻量级cms解决方案,全部代码开源(开源许可证协议及版权声明)、可免费商用。其独有的实时配置增删改查的功能,是其区别于同类cms的最大特点,也是最大优势,极大的减少了重复劳动,同时又极大的增加了cms的灵活性。tjpcms信奉以约定替代配置,致力于对业务层代码的零入侵性。懂jsp即可实现快速建站、静态化等,学习成本极低。文档齐全,持续更新,完备的 视频教程 为你提供全方位的提升,欢迎下载使用!

 

tjpcms有什么用?

这是所有读者最核心的疑问!网上的开源框架多如牛毛,但往往讲了一大堆,读者也没搞清楚框架究竟能帮使用者做什么。tjpcms最核心的作用就是:帮助java web开发者以动态配置的方式完成增删改查的页面及功能。具体是个什么意思呢,可以举个栗子看一下tjpcms动态如何配置增删改查

下载下来的tjpcms怎么用?

下载下来的压缩包是工程源码及数据库文件,将源码导入到MyEclipse中,数据库导入到Mysql中,再配置一下工程中数据链接,就可以访问啦!具体可见 视频教程 和 环境配置

tjpcms用到或参考了哪些组件和框架?

底层是Java,数据库是Mysql,开发框架是spring MVC,数据库层是MyBatis,后端用到的都是很大众化的。前端主要用到或参考了ueditor、layui、artTemplate、pintuer、ligerUI、iconfont、Ztree等,前端综合要求更高。

tjpcms能帮我做什么?

通俗来说,其实就是帮助你以最便捷的方式将各种类型的数据规范入库,尽可能少写代码,越少越好,做到极致,功能及页面都靠配置来完成,且能够即时修改即时显示,再配合一些工具及技巧(也因此我称之为解决方案而非框架)就极大地提升了效率。cms只管后台的数据入库,显示由前台负责,因此可互不干扰同步开发,具体参见教程。

tjpcms相比其他cms有什么优势?

1、实时配置增删改查。以后台友情链接功能为例,增删改查、校验、图片上传等功能及相关页面,仅需12行代码完成最普通的单表(友情链接页面)

2、官方JSTL模板。前台模板采用官方的JSTL,不需要额外学习其他模板如FreeMarker、Smarty或其他cms自行开发的小众模板,用JSTL即可实现整站及局部静态化,显著降低了学习成本。

3、极简设计,提倡减法。坚决避免同类产品的复杂繁冗,仅保留构成cms所需要的最基本功能和表单参数,功能和页面力求简洁易懂,以简为美,由此极大地方便了二次开发。

4、扎实的教程。作者从切身体会出发,深知配套教程的重要性,因此精心编写了一组使用文档,亲测每一个步骤,力求为用户的使用提供最大程度的方便。

tjpcms开源许可证协议及版权声明

 

tjpcms开源许可证采取双授权的模式:

1、对于使用tjpcms来搭建网站,以网站作为产品的:开源许可证采用MIT 协议,个人参考学习、商用均免费,可以闭源,可以以tjpcms作为产品宣传,但你的产品中必须包含tjpcms的著作权声明。

2、对于引用、参考、使用、借鉴、模仿、复制、修改tjpcms的代码等行为来制作cms、crm、erp、OA、后台系统、管理系统等软件,或以此为产品进行销售、分发、传播、复制、云服务等行为:需作者本人授权。

任何情况下,作者保留tjpcms的著作权,保留对作品中自研部分及相关设计和创意等申请专利的权利,任何人不得违法侵犯!若tjpcms无意侵犯了您的合法权益,请及时告知作者(QQ:57454144)。

tjpcms是作者在实际使用各类cms系统过程中不断提炼升华出来、面向java web开发者的一套快速建站解决方案,初衷就是和广大java web的开发者一起分享cms类网站的设计及实现,大家共同进步,而且本身也参考采用了许多的优秀的前后端的开源框架,但开发过程凝结了作者的心血,作品也有诸多创新之处,因此综合考量后采用上述双授权模式。使用者务必严格遵守本系统声明的许可证协议,如有违反,保留法律追诉的权利,若有不明白之处可以与作者直接联系。

 

tjpcms的理念有哪些?

1、面向的受众是开发者而非普通用户。专业的事情交给专业的人去做,要使用tjpcms必须会java web开发,普通用户是无法使用tjpcms的。

2、纯信息发布类的cms网站没有生命力。网站要能够发挥实际作用、解决痛点问题就必须要整合业务进去,所以基于cms的二次开发是常态。

3、功能少了不方便,多了又复杂,但少总比多好。需求是千变万化,甚至意想不到的,很多功能可能用户根本就用不上,还不如没有。

  • 大小: 68.5 KB
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ics